Campaign Optimization Pricing Models Explained: Choosing the Right Fit
When it comes to online advertising, budgets are a crucial factor. To ensure your promotional activities yield maximum profitability, understanding various campaign cost structures is essential. These models determine how you pay for campaigns, influencing outcomes. A common model is cost-per-click (CPC), where you only are charged upon each time someone interacts with your campaign. Cost-per-impression (CPM) is calculated by the number of times your ad is shown, while cost-per-acquisition (CPA) focuses on the cost per conversion for each desired action. Consider factors like your marketing objectives and audience demographics to choose the best-fit structure for your needs.
